Abstract

The present invention provides a method comprising, mixing at least one phenol with a 1-bromopropane product mixture to form a phenol-containing 1-bromopropane product mixture, and obtaining the phenol-containing 1-bromopropane product mixture The purified 1-bromopropane product is recovered from the mixture. The present invention also provides a process for the preparation of a 1-bromopropane product mixture from 1-propanol and hydrogen bromide, characterized in that at least one phenol is mixed with the 1-bromopropane product mixture to form a A 1-bromopropane product mixture of phenol, and a purified 1-bromopropane product recovered from the phenol-containing 1-bromopropane product mixture.

[0001] The present invention relates to 1-bromopropane products having a reduced tendency to form acids during storage, and to methods of producing such products. Background technique

[0002] 1-Bromopropane (also known as n-propyl bromide or propyl bromide) can be used as a degreasing agent, especially for degreasing metal parts, and in cleaning solutions in circuit board production. In these applications, the presence of certain impurities in the 1-bromopropane is undesirable because these impurities have detrimental effects on the substrate with which the 1-bromopropane comes into contact. At the time of manufacture, the starting 1-bromopropane product mixture contained impurities including 2-bromopropane (isopropyl bromide), 1,2-dibromopropane, monobromoethylketone, 1-propanol, propionaldehyde, One or more of propionic acid, water and hydrogen bromide (HBr).
